Description

CASH BUYERS ONLY
Orchard Cottage is an attractive double-fronted end of terrace period home, occupying a truly exceptional plot in the very heart of Knutsford in the sought-after St John’s Conservation Area. Properties offering this level of space, character and off-street parking in such a central location are exceptionally rare.
The house retains a wealth of period charm, beginning with a welcoming entrance hall and extending through two elegant reception rooms, ideal for both family living and entertaining. The ground floor also offers a kitchen, utility room and downstairs WC, providing a practical layout with excellent potential for modernisation. Upstairs are four well-proportioned bedrooms and a family bathroom, while beneath the house are full cellar chambers with both internal and external access, offering further flexibility for storage or conversion (subject to consents).
Set within sprawling gardens, the property benefits from gated access and off-street parking. A garage previously occupied part of the plot and could be easily reinstated, if desired. With significant scope for extension and enhancement (subject to planning permission), Orchard Cottage presents a rare and exciting opportunity to create a superb town-centre home tailored to individual tastes.
Offered with no onward chain, this is a brilliant opportunity to acquire a period property with outstanding potential in one of Knutsford’s most desirable locations.
Cash buyers only due to the level of work required. A standard residential mortgage will not be possible.

  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
  • Cost-to-rent — Price ÷ annual rent (from OpenRent comparables). Under 14× = strong, 14–16× = acceptable, 17×+ = compressed.
  • Cashflow — Rent minus mortgage, 10% maintenance, £25/mo compliance. Assumes 75% LTV, 3.95% APR (5yr fixed), 25yr term.
  • ROI — Annual profit ÷ cash in (deposit + 4% purchase costs).
